Improve Your Well-being: A Vitamin Guide

Feeling drained or simply wanting to optimize your overall health? Explore the world of supplements! This isn't about replacing a nutritious diet; it's about filling gaps that your body might need. Before you start a new routine, it's always crucial to speak with your physician. Frequently used supplements include Vitamin D, particularly during less sunny months, to promote bone strength and mood. Omega-3 fatty acids, found in fish oil or vegan alternatives, are beneficial for heart function and lessening inflammation. Magnesium is another effective option for nervous performance and relaxation. Remember, quality matters – choose supplements from reliable brands that have been tested for purity and potency. A customized approach, guided by qualified advice, is the best way to realize the greatest potential of supplements to support your wellness process.

Uptake & Vitamins: Maximizing Intake

When it comes to nutritional support, simply taking a pill doesn't guarantee you’re reaping all the rewards. Bioavailability, the extent to which a compound is taken up and available to the body, plays a critical role. Several elements can affect bioavailability, including the type of the ingredient itself, interactions with other elements in your diet, and even your unique digestive health. To improve your mineral outcomes, consider approaches like choosing easily absorbed versions – such as methylfolate instead of folic acid – or pairing products with meals that facilitate assimilation. Ultimately, understanding and addressing bioavailability is key to truly getting the most out of your nutritional regimen.
